The Role:
We are looking for a proactive and reliable Stores Person to join our busy Northampton branch team. This is a vital, hands-on role where you will be an integral part of our operations, ensuring the smooth running of the warehouse and contributing to our commitment to customer satisfaction. There is scope for progression for the right candidate who is keen to learn all aspects of the electrical wholesale business, from stores to the trade counter.
Key Responsibilities:
Receiving and Dispatching Goods:
Accurately receive, check, and sign for incoming deliveries, reporting any discrepancies or damaged stock immediately.
Stock Management:
Organise stock efficiently in the warehouse and on shelves, perform regular stock checks, manage returns, and maintain accurate inventory records using our computerised system.
Order Fulfilment:
Accurately pick and pack customer orders for collection or delivery, ensuring they are ready according to schedule.
Trade Counter Support:
Assist on the trade counter when required, serving customers face-to-face and over the phone, providing high-quality service and building professional relationships.
Warehouse Maintenance:
Ensure the warehouse is kept clean, tidy, safe, and secure at all times, adhering to all health and safety guidelines.
General Duties:
Assist with other branch tasks as needed, including van loading/unloading etc.
